Global Surf Tourism Grinds To A Halt Due To Covid 19 Pandemic

Authorities started to close beaches on the Bukit Peninsula in Bali this week, leaving lineups that are usually teeming with surfers from across the globe all but empty. “There was one person out at Uluwatu on Tuesday,” said resident photographer Hamish Humphries. “It was head high and offshore. He must have snuck out somehow because they’ve closed Padang Padang, they’ve closed Uluwatu, and there’s probably more to follow.” The lockdown on the Bukit beaches follows a recent spate of coronavirus deaths on the island....

How To Do A Perfect Squat

“Squats are bad for the knees” is the biggest myth in weight training. You may have heard that full squats are bad for your back, too. The correctly performed squat is a hips-dependent exercise. It doesn’t really stress the knees much at all. And the correct position at the bottom of the squat does in fact load the back. Which is fine, because the squat is a back exercise too....
